Understanding Land Transaction Fraud: Common Types and Red Flags
### Understanding Land Transaction Fraud: Common Types and Red Flags
Securing your land transaction from fraud is essential for landowners who want to protect their property rights and financial investments. Land transaction fraud can take many forms, from forged documents to identity theft. One common type is title fraud, where a fraudster unlawfully transfers ownership of a property by forging signatures or creating fake documents. Another prevalent issue is mortgage fraud, where false information is provided to secure loans against a parcel of land that isn’t owned by the fraudster. Red flags you should look for include discrepancies in property titles, unexpected changes in ownership records, and offers that seem too good to be true. Always ensure that you conduct thorough due diligence, such as hiring a reputable title company or a real estate attorney, to help ensure your transaction remains secure.
Importance of Title Insurance in Protecting Your Investment
When it comes to securing your land transaction from fraud, title insurance plays a critical role. Title insurance protects property owners from losses arising out of defects in the title of the property. This could include issues like unknown liens, claims against the property, or fraud that may not have been uncovered during the purchase process. By obtaining title insurance, landowners can safeguard their investments and ensure that they can enjoy their property without the looming threat of legal disputes over ownership. As an added layer of protection, title insurance often covers legal costs and any potential losses arising from claims against your property title, giving landowners peace of mind.

Conducting Due Diligence: Researching Property History and Ownership
### Conducting Due Diligence: Researching Property History and Ownership
When engaging in real estate transactions, particularly when buying or selling parcels of land, it’s vital to conduct thorough due diligence. This means investigating the property’s history and current ownership, which is essential for securing your land transaction from fraud. A property title search is a critical first step; it reveals the legal owner of the land and whether there are any liens, disputes, or encumbrances against the title. These issues can complicate or even derail a sale. Additionally, reviewing historical records can help you ascertain past ownership, which may uncover any potential legal disputes that could arise from prior owners.
Furthermore, it’s also advisable to consult local property records, as this can provide insights into the land’s zoning classifications and possible future uses. By understanding the property’s past and confirming its legal status, you significantly reduce the risks associated with fraudulent transactions. Always consider working with experienced professionals, such as real estate agents or legal experts, to guide you through the complexities of land ownership laws and ensure a smooth process.
